: A file named mimetype should be the first file in the Zip. It must be uncompressed and contain the ASCII-encoded media type (e.g., application/vnd.oasis.opendocument.text ).

: In the Zip file's central directory, encrypted entries must be flagged as "STORED" even though they contain compressed data.
